
Apusic
文章平均质量分 64
mortimer_c
人称陈老师,早期一直从事Java企业级应用研发与项目管理工作,亦有带团队经历。目前做技术顾问,著有JavaScript从入门到精通清华大学出版社WebSphereChina第14期主编,并负责撰写云计算相关文章,对SOA云计算有自己独到的见解。
展开
-
AAS如何禁止自动重启应用
之前曾经有客户将文件上传的目录放在应用目录下,而AAS默认会自动部署变化的应用,导致用户一上传文件,便会发生session丢失的问题。同时,经过几次上传便会内存溢出:java.lang.OutOfMemoryError: Java perm space最终,客户应用将文件上传目录移出应用目录,系统便不再发生异常。此问题,如果不允许将目录移出,可以调整AAS的参数,从而禁用自动部署,防止文件变化后的原创 2013-08-02 23:46:03 · 2954 阅读 · 0 评论 -
访问linux下部署于AAS的应用Could not initialize class sun.awt.X11GraphicsEnvironment的问题
同一个应用,在windows平台下开发,测试阶段没问题,然后部署到linux平台下,使用IE浏览器访问,验证码(验证码以图片形式展现),总是显示不出来。然后,改用火狐浏览器,直接在浏览器抛出:java.lang.NoClassDefFoundError: Could not initialize class sun.awt.X11GraphicsEnvironment at java.lang.原创 2012-05-09 13:44:56 · 10361 阅读 · 2 评论 -
深入了解ApusicAS服务器配置系列之——SSL配置
近日,随着铁路客服中心网上购票系统中逐步可以购买大部分车次的列车,12306网站的种种问题便暴露出来,估计现在信息中心及系统开发商正在紧锣密鼓关注系统运行状态,并绞尽脑汁查找一切可以优化的地方进行优化,来满足数量惊人的火车票订票需求。先撇开性能问题不谈,使用过12306的朋友可能都注意到了,在使用12306进行网上购票之前,需要下载一个根证书到本地,然后,按照相关文件的说明,将证书导入IE浏览器,原创 2012-01-12 17:13:11 · 3752 阅读 · 0 评论 -
AAS 7.0下一个Error content type错误的处理
近日,合作伙伴在使用AAS 7.0的时候,碰到一个后台抛异常,前端没问题的现象:一点击应用中的“导出Excel”,后台即抛出如下异常:2011-12-07 09:55:06 错误 [apusic.web.response] Error content type: application/x-msdownload;java.lang.StringIndexOutOfBoundsException:原创 2011-12-14 16:16:41 · 2581 阅读 · 0 评论 -
深入了解ApusicAS服务器配置系列之——AAS集群:使用第三方负载均衡器相关配置
ApusicAS集群对第三方的负载均衡(如:硬件负载均衡器F5,软件负载均衡器Apache Server,微软的IIS等)提供良好的支持。当使用第三方的负载均衡器时,AAS的Session复制同样采用内存复制技术,及AAS的Session复制不会调整,但是由于Apusic Loadbalancer原生提供对Session的状态备份,而第三方负载均衡器则无法提供相应的功能。因此,AAS采用了使用IP原创 2011-12-21 11:06:19 · 3903 阅读 · 1 评论 -
深入了解ApusicAS服务器配置系列之——AAS集群:使用Apusic Loadbalancer相关配置
集群是解决应用的高性能与高可用的一种技术,就目前的常规Java EE应用中,最常见最常用的就是Web集群。更规范一些说,web集群就是解决两个问题:客户请求的负载均衡和Session的高可用。客户请求的负载均衡是指客户的请求依赖特定算法被合理地分配给多台Web Server来处理。Session的高可用性是指当某台Web Server失效,这台Web Server服务的客户的请求会被透明地转发给其原创 2011-12-18 16:23:48 · 5909 阅读 · 0 评论 -
深入了解ApusicAS服务器配置系列之——配置虚拟主机
虚拟主机的用处不再赘述。但是简单介绍一下虚拟主机的用处:某个Apusic AS上部署了一个名为app1的Web应用,当客户端通过浏览器发出对名为www.hostname.com的域名的请求时,由app1应用提供响应。这种需求在Apusic AS中,为某个应用配置虚拟主机是非常方便的。只需要在应用所在的%APUSIC_DOMAIN_APP_CONFIG%下的server.xml文件的内容进行简单修改原创 2011-11-07 19:37:11 · 2090 阅读 · 0 评论 -
深入了解ApusicAS服务器配置系列之——配置Web上下文根
虽然AAS是最常见也是实施最多的产品,但是,实际中使用到的往往是最常见的一些配置内容,遇到某些特殊情况,往往有些不知所措。针对这一状况,决定将AAS的配置文件做一个较深入的研究,从而能在最大程度上了解AAS各种配置文件及其参数的实际意义。如果可能的话,本系列会慢慢持续,直至基本介绍完成所有的配置为止。实际应用中,配置应用的上下文根是最常见也是看起来信手拈来的操作与配置(需求往往是设置默认应用,原创 2011-11-02 19:52:06 · 3390 阅读 · 2 评论 -
深入了解ApusicAS服务器配置系列之——AAS日志服务配置
日志可以记录服务器的很多内容,因此,通过日志服务可以详细记录服务器运行中可能出现的各种问题,从而为解决问题提供重要依据,另外,管理员通过日志也可以随时了解服务器的运行状态。因此,配置一个正确的日志服务是以后服务器维护的重要基础。AAS 内置的日志服务其实主要包含两部分:一个是通过logging.xml文件配置的服务器全局的日志配置以及某些应用可能会用到的日志服务,另外一个是 AAS的com.apu原创 2011-11-14 19:48:13 · 3702 阅读 · 0 评论 -
关于为什么AAS默认编码是ISO-8859-1的说明
曾经在项目中发现客户的某些页面存在乱码,但是是个别情况,并不是全部,于是很奇怪,直接把相关页面拿过来看,结果发现,此页面中没有任何关于页面编码的声明。比如:或者等等,没有任何声明,只有最简单的基本html,甚至这几个页面除了基本html以外,没有什么其他jsp相关的内容,只是被命名为jsp文件。但是,在aas默认环境下运行时,乱码!但是,在aas运行过程的日志中可以看出,页面在解析时使用的是ISO原创 2013-08-20 10:04:04 · 2974 阅读 · 2 评论